Output 5ebe2caa3d59573cfec8e14d66df5681d7f19ecf51e81df900fef8450a768a20:20

value
69028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a629443bb33facea93ae195675f41c401e8fef OP_EQUAL
address
3B3muC91FnZWKrDeGs81eLndt5D3GvAfbF
transaction
5ebe2caa3d59573cfec8e14d66df5681d7f19ecf51e81df900fef8450a768a20
spent
true